WebThe observable traits expressed by an organism are referred to as its phenotype. An organism’s underlying genetic makeup, consisting of both the physically visible and the non-expressed alleles, is called its genotype. Mendel’s hybridization experiments demonstrate the difference between phenotype and genotype. WebPhenotypes are determined by an interaction of genes and the environment, but the mechanism for each gene and phenotype is different. WebIf the two mutations are in the same gene, the offspring show the mutant phenotype, because they still will have no normal copies of the gene in question (see Panel 8-1, pp. 526–527). If, in contrast, the mutations fall in different genes, the resulting offspring show a normal phenotype. They retain one normal copy (and one mutant copy) of ...
